Types of Meat-Based Snacks
When selecting meat-based snacks, options like **beef jerky**, **pork rinds**, and **beef sticks** are standout choices. Beef jerky is particularly popular due to its convenience and ability to deliver a protein punch while remaining shelf-stable. On the other hand, **pork cracklings** and **pork rinds** are excellent for those who enjoy a crunch. These products not only satisfy cravings but also keep carb intake minimal as they offer **zero carb snacks** alternatives.

The Versatility of Canned Meats
Canned meats, including **Spam** and tuna, offer a **convenient snack** that’s ready to eat. Packed with protein and often low in calories, they can be easily added to a lunchbox or eaten as a quick bite at home. 7. What should I consider when purchasing meat snacks?
When purchasing meat snacks, it's important to review ingredient labels for quality. Aim for options that are high in **protein**, low in carbohydrates, and offer few added sugars or preservatives. Look for **sustainable** sourcing whenever possible.
